Image forward motion compensation method for some aerial reconnaissance camera based on neural network predictive control (EI CONFERENCE)

In this paper
neural network predictive control method is used to compensate the image forward motion of a certain aerial reconnaissance camera and we have solved several problems that traditional control methods have. Firstly
according to the principle of imaging
we analyzed the reasons for the existence of image forward motion and established the mathematical model. Secondly
we analyzed the theoretically feasibility of the method. At last
simulation
experiments and test are used to validate the practical feasibility. Through what we have done
we conclude that neural network predictive control method can be used to compensate image forward motion for this certain camera and can make a perfect performance. 2011 Springer-Verlag.
Image motion compensation for a certain aviation camera based on Lucy-Richardson algorithm (EI CONFERENCE)

According to the actual situation
when high quality and high precision are required for the image
both beforehand and afterwards compensation should be used. In this paper
we use Lucy-Richardson algorithm to compensate image motion of a certain aviation camera as an afterwards compensation. Firstly
we analyze the imaging principle of the camera and the reasons that cause image motion. Then we have a brief introduce of the Lucy-Richardson algorithm. At last
in order to show the feasibility of the method
we do some simulation. Through theoretical and practical analysis
experiments and test
we conclude the Lucy-Richardson algorithm can be used to compensate image motion for the certain camera. 2011 IEEE.
